在网页设计领域,将PSD(Photoshop Document)格式的设计稿转换为HTML是常见的工作流程,当您手头有一个宽度为1920像素的PSD文件时,这意味着该设计是为横向分辨率至少为1920像素的显示器优化的,通常用于桌面或笔记本电脑屏幕,要将这样的设计有效地转换成HTML,需要遵循一系列步骤来确保设计的精确呈现。
准备工作
在开始编写HTML之前,您需要确保拥有所有必要的设计资源,这包括图像、图标、字体文件等,确认PSD文件中的所有图层都已正确命名,这将有助于识别各个元素并简化编码过程。
切片和导出
使用Photoshop的切片工具(Slice Tool),您可以把PSD文件分割成多个部分,每个切片可以对应于一个HTML元素,例如头部、导航栏、内容区域、侧边栏和页脚。
1、选择切片工具:在Photoshop的工具箱中选择切片工具。
2、创建切片:在PSD上拖动以创建切片区域,确保每个切片都包含您想要转换为HTML的元素。
3、命名切片:给每个切片命名,最好使用描述性名称以方便理解每个部分的功能。
4、导出:选择“文件” > “导出” > “另存为Web所用格式”,然后选择适当的格式和质量设置来导出您的切片。
编写HTML结构
现在,您已经准备好了所有的图像资源和切片,接下来是编写HTML代码的时候了。
1、设置文档类型:在文档的顶部声明<!DOCTYPE html>
,并设置meta标签以适应不同的设备。
2、创建HTML骨架:建立基本的HTML结构,包括<html>
, <head>
和<body>
标签。
3、构建布局:使用<div>
元素来构建页面布局,并根据PSD中的切片来定位这些<div>
元素。
4、插入内容:将文本、链接和图像插入到相应的<div>
中。
5、添加样式:使用CSS来应用颜色、字体、边距和填充等样式,以确保布局与PSD设计匹配。
6、调整响应式:通过媒体查询(Media Queries)和其他响应式设计技术,确保在不同设备上也能良好显示。
测试和验证
完成HTML编码后,需要在多种浏览器和设备上进行测试,以确保兼容性和响应能力。
浏览器测试:在Chrome、Firefox、Safari和Edge等主流浏览器上测试您的网页。
设备测试:确保您的网页在各种屏幕尺寸和分辨率上都表现正常。
验证代码:使用W3C的HTML验证器检查代码的正确性。
优化和性能
不要忘记对代码进行优化以提高加载速度和性能,压缩图像、最小化CSS和JavaScript文件以及利用缓存都是提升性能的有效手段。
相关问题与解答
问题1: 如何确保HTML页面在不同设备上的兼容性?
答案: 为了确保HTML页面在不同设备上的兼容性,应使用响应式设计技术,包括使用百分比而非固定像素值来定义布局尺寸,利用媒体查询来根据不同设备的屏幕尺寸调整样式,以及使用flexbox或grid系统来创建灵活的布局结构。
问题2: 在转换PSD到HTML的过程中,如果PSD中的一些元素在HTML中无法精确复现怎么办?
答案: 如果某些PSD设计元素在HTML中难以实现,可以考虑以下几种解决方案:使用SVG(可缩放矢量图形)替代复杂图形;查找第三方库或插件来实现特定功能;或者与设计师协商,寻找可接受的替代方案,有时,一些视觉效果可能需要用更简单的方法重新设计,以便于在网页上实现。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/292867.html